From garro

the new rulebooks
Got a guided read through of the new rulebooks, and they look really good. they’ll be up for pre-order within a couple of weeks, individually and with a limited edition bundle with the slipcase.

The core rulebook has been completely organised and laid out. The core book has a nice chunk of background and maps at the beginning, and the ‘basic’ and ‘advanced’ rules have been complied into just being ‘rules’. so no more flicking through to find certain parts of the same rules. the book also has all the GW scenerios, and the domination campaign, as that was decided to be the better and more popular of the two systems. They’ve also took the time to tidy up some language and other things in this as well (will be covered in the FAQs). For example, the ‘pistol’ weapon trait has been renamed ‘sidearm’ so to avoid confusion with the Pistol category in the trading post. same goes for the lower ‘wargear’ title in the house lists being renamed ‘personal equipment’ so the rule “all fighters can take wargear” refers to armour, grenades, and personal equipment clearly. also the reputation restriction on how many champions you can have is completely gone, to match the GSC and Chaos cults lists.

Its important that I say that these compiled books don’t outright invalidate your existing rulebook and gang war books. the rules, as they should be being played, will be staying 99.9% the same. the new books simply collects it all together, takes the opportunity to clear some things up. Personally feel they’re still very much worth it.

Regarding the gangs book, this contains the 6 house gangs, brutes, pets, hangers-on, named characters, bounty hunters, and hired scum rules, as well as the trading post, weapons stats and traits, and the skills lists as well. This is well laid out with the gangs in alphabetical order, each with their couple of pages of lore at the beginning. there is also some new artwork scattered into both books.
House Delaques
got to have a look at Delaques house list quickly and there’s some really cool stuff on it. they’ve got probably the best special weapons list out of the core 6 gangs, but only have the heavy flamer in their heavy weapons list as big loud weapons don’t fit their MO, but burning the evidence does. (remember you can still get the rest in the trading post). they’ve got a Flechette pistol, and throwing daggers are in the regular weapons list alongside your standard rifles. they’ve got grav and web weapons in their pistol and special weapons lists as well. won’t detail their brute and pet as they were shown on twitch a few days ago, and later posted all over social media already.
YEAR TWO and even future.
With the core 6 gangs now (functionally) out, and the rulebooks compiled, I’m sure sure you’re all wondering where next. well I can tell you it won’t just be spending year two doing ‘outlanders’. Let me be clear, the gangs from the outlanders expansion WILL be coming. but they will not all be lined up as the next four gangs, there will be other gangs released in amongst them. SG will be keeping up the ‘plastic release every quarter’, but did say that they might not all be gangs. I said would that mean that things like the brutes might be getting plastic kits instead of resin like some of the Blood Bowl big guys, but they wouldn’t give a straight yes or no, only that could. they’ve already got the next two gang kits finished, and all of the main rules/lore stuff written that will be released this year, with the following several years planned out, so its safe to say that Necromunda is going to be supported for quite some time. Also got confirmation that Necromunda stuff will be at the HH weekender, but looks like it will more than likely take a back seat this time round compared to being ‘equal partners’ like this year.

I would like to comment a few things:

zamerion wrote:

The core rulebook has been completely organised and laid out. The core book has a nice chunk of background and maps at the beginning, and the ‘basic’ and ‘advanced’ rules have been complied into just being ‘rules’. so no more flicking through to find certain parts of the same rules.

That's very good.
zamerion wrote:

the book also has all the GW scenerios, and the domination campaign, as that was decided to be the better and more popular of the two systems.

I'm interested to see if those include the scenarios from the GW1 or the Leader's Accessories Pack. Or rewritten again into a 3rd version. Also, that probably excludes the white dwarf scenarios, so probably will not be a 100% complete collection.

Dominion may very well be better, but I don't think there's much data saying it is more popular. Keep in mind, Turf War campaign was released November 2017. This campaign was the only one played until August 2018, when Dominion was released. That's just 3 months ago. I imagine most players would want to test out the new campaign during this time (having played Turf War for 9 months), so if it is more popular, that could be simply because it is new.
zamerion wrote:

They’ve also took the time to tidy up some language and other things in this as well (will be covered in the FAQs). For example, the ‘pistol’ weapon trait has been renamed ‘sidearm’ so to avoid confusion with the Pistol category in the trading post. same goes for the lower ‘wargear’ title in the house lists being renamed ‘personal equipment’ so the rule “all fighters can take wargear” refers to armour, grenades, and personal equipment clearly.

That's very good, we've seen many complaints about this.
zamerion wrote:

also the reputation restriction on how many champions you can have is completely gone, to match the GSC and Chaos cults lists.

That's somewhat strange actually, because the limitless champs are actually a result of the Dominion Campaign. The cults v1 had the same champ limit as everyone else. They removed that limit for the cults v2 when Dominion campaign was released.
zamerion wrote:

Its important that I say that these compiled books don’t outright invalidate your existing rulebook and gang war books. the rules, as they should be being played, will be staying 99.9% the same. the new books simply collects it all together, takes the opportunity to clear some things up. Personally feel they’re still very much worth it.

I would argue differently. The compiled books completely invalidates and outdates the existing rulebook (almost completely garbage by now) and large parts of the Gang War books. Every time they released a new rules document (book, pdf, white dwarf article) they ALWAYS change something. The longer you look back, the more has changed. If you still decide to use the existing books instead of the new compilation, be aware that you'll have numerous contradictions and conflicts, which means if you don't know what exactly book AND page to look for a certain weapon stat, trait, skill, cost, scenario or anything else, chances are you're getting incorrect information. There's also many changes in the new compilation that you can't find anywhere in any existing publication.
